Introduction

UJInvnt is an Intellectual Property Holding Company the purpose and activity of which will be the acquisition exploitation licensing or sublicensing of patents trademarks copyrights brand names or other industrial property rights like know-how on technical or administrative matters.

Duties & Responsibilities

UJInvnt - Its primary objectives are:

  • to commercialise on behalf of the University opportunities arising from the activities of the University and others including but not limited to Intellectual Property (IP) through several permutations which range from commercialising IP (licensing sale of IP assets) to owning equity stakes in new ventures (with outside investors) based on IP assets
  • to provide technical and training services consultancy services and courses; and
  • to hold shares on behalf of the Shareholder in other subsidiary companies and act as the Holding Company for commercial activities.

Job Purpose:

This role is responsible for providing high-level administrative and coordination support to the Executive Manager: UJInvnt ensuring efficient operation of the office and requires exceptional organizational skills discretion and the ability to manage complex calendars communications and confidential information.

Responsibilities:

  • Manage the Executive Managers office and to act as first line of contact to all stakeholders in a professional manner.
  • Administer procurement of operational and capital items to enable efficient functioning in the Executive Managers office.
  • Manage the processing and payment of Board Directors remunerations and claims.
  • Develop and manage ongoing monthly budget control for the Executive Managers office.
  • Arrange travel and accommodation for the Executive Manager for official business trips and conferences.
  • Compile and administer relevant reports for various committees and forums.
  • Arrange and co-ordinate meetings workshops functions conferences and allied events as per the requirements of the Executive Manager and the Board of Directors.
  • Ensure the work within Company is aligned to the university and company procedures processes and policies
  • Pre-screen documents sent through for the Executives approval to ensure alignment with Delegation of Authority and compliance with relevant processes and procedures of the company.
  • Ensure that the booked venues comply with the Occupational Health & Safety protocols.
  • Arrange logistics for meetings seminars workshops and other events.
  • Act as a liaison between the company university and external entities.
